Peter Brandt, a trader long known for his blunt view of crypto, said many digital assets will end up as junk even as he singled out XRP as the strongest candidate for transactional use. The comment came during a Crypto Banter interview with Ran Neuner and drew quick notice after Neuner said he did not expect that answer. Related Reading: Bitcoin Bottom Not In Yet? He also put Solana and Ethereum in the same group, but the XRP pick stood out because he has spent years taking shots at the token and at its supporters. His comments carried a split message. On one hand, he gave XRP credit for possible real-world transaction use; on the other, he said most cryptocurrencies will not survive in any meaningful way.
